Abstract
A torque control shutoff clutch for power tools is provided with a torque recovery camming device which assists in decoupling the applied power of the clutch along with the shutting off of the motor driving the power tool. The clutch permits automatic reset of the device upon release of the throttle trigger and further throttles air flow to the power source just prior to shutoff thereby minimizing operator shutoff torque reaction.
